MINUTES — MANAGEMENT MEETING

Attendees reviewed the second-source search for the Bramwick valve assembly. Delgano Fabrication and Orrister Works passed initial audits; sample tooling due within six weeks. Ms. Tavenner will brief the incoming director on qualification criteria and cost deltas before final shortlisting. The appended confidential note sets out how this search fits our broader plans.

board note of kageg-bahof: The renewal with Holwynax Holdings closes at $2 million a year, 5 percent below the last contract. Project Ulaath slips by two quarters because of the supplier delay.

Support team context: scaling now handles fractional yields correctly, but unit conversion between weight and volume still relies on the density table, which only covers about 60 ingredients. Tickets about odd results for uncommon ingredients are expected; tag them "density-gap" rather than "bug." The rounding setting defaults to nearest quarter unit; users can change it in preferences, and many don't find it. Known issue: halving a recipe with a single egg produces a warning, not an error. Escalations go to the new owner.

account owner for bawip-tahag: Raleth Quenok

Test plan — Bramblecove SFTP drop (partner: Ostrell Foods)

Scope: nightly inventory files land in /incoming at 02:00. Validate: filename pattern, checksum sidecar present, reject zero-byte files, quarantine malformed rows. New folks: do NOT test against the partner's production drop; use the Bramblecove sandbox host only. Files over 50MB should chunk automatically — verify the manifest reflects all parts. Rerun the full suite after any parser change. To authenticate against the sandbox verification API, use the bearer token below.

session JWT of yawep-yawep = eyJhbGciOiJIUzI1NiIsInR5cCI6IkpXVCJ9.eyJzdWIiOiI3pWF3_In0.aXYsHiog